Methadone is a drug used in the reduction of harm associated with opiate addiction and dependency. A person who wants to stop using prescription pain killers or heroin can get started on a methadone program in or near Falls Creek where they take it on a daily basis to avoid withdrawal, avoid cravings and essentially replace their addiction with a legal medication. Many individuals who start methadone treatment stay on the drug for many years, considering withdrawing off it can bring about withdrawal symptoms far greater than even heroin withdrawal. Methadone is a full opioid agonist, similar to heroin and morphine. However, it's effects last much longer which is why detoxing from it can be so harsh and last so long. And considering methadone can stay in the body for so long, users usually will not even begin feeling the effects of withdrawal for a day or two if they stop taking it cold turkey. Methadone withdrawal is similar to that of other opiates, and are likened to a really bad flu and may include fever, chills, nausea and vomiting, profuse sweating muscle and bone aches and pain, stomach cramping, extreme insomnia, etc.

Methadone detoxification can be made more comfortable and manageable in a detox facility that allow patients withdrawing from the drug. Some centers provide a medically managed detox while others help the client withdrawal off the drug without the use of controlled medications.
